Now it is being investigated for its results within the atypical chemokine receptor (ACK3). Inside of a rat model, it was located that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ory exercise, producing an General rise in opiate receptor activity.

Scientists have lately identified and succeeded in synthesizing conolidine, a natural compound that reveals guarantee as being a strong analgesic agent with a more favorable protection profile. Although the exact mechanism of motion stays elusive, it is now postulated that conolidine could possibly have several biologic targets. Presently, conolidine is revealed to inhibit Cav2.2 calcium conolidine channels and raise the availability of endogenous opioid peptides by binding to your not too long ago determined opioid scavenger ACKR3. Even though the identification of conolidine as a potential novel analgesic agent delivers yet another avenue to address the opioid crisis and take care of CNCP, additional scientific tests are essential to be aware of its system of motion and utility and efficacy in managing CNCP.

Synthetic conolidine was very first created in 2011, and there are couple of studies of its security, success, and correct dosage at this stage. See this the latest paper:

And investigation remains on-going on what could be a safe and therapeutic does, together with any prolonged-term challenges, just before it is prepared for prime time.
